JEDDAH, 15 December 2003 — Saudi Aramco has won first place in a list of international oil companies published by Petroleum Intelligence Weekly. The company won for its oil and gas production and reserves as well as its refining and sales capabilities, the Saudi Press Agency reported. The Saudi oil giant holds the top position on the weekly’s annual list for the 15th consecutive year, the agency added. “This international recognition increases our responsibility to remain a dependable energy source for the Kingdom and the world,” said Abdullah Juma, the company’s president and CEO. He said 2002 was a year of achievements for Saudi Aramco.
